Output 67ab2821de45b76fdc4a1745e0b3fed25de2ceaa0bf21c215351cca8ca5fbfc3:0

value
12366868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5184c228200596a6fb218a010d900a666e65bbbf OP_EQUAL
address
MFLC1BiL17uJLpPYMeQEhar3ouz2edKGE2
transaction
67ab2821de45b76fdc4a1745e0b3fed25de2ceaa0bf21c215351cca8ca5fbfc3
spent
true